The National Aeronautics and Space Administration is an agency of the United States government, responsible for the nation’s public space program. NASA was established on July 29, 1958, by the National Aeronautics and Space Act.

In addition to the space program, it is also responsible for long-term civilian and military aerospace research.

let’s first talk a bit about how it was created

after the launch of sputnik 1 by the soviet, on october 4 , 1957 , the united states had for the first time felt the power of the URSS, and decided then to double the efforts to face what was considered at that time as a threat to US security and technological leadership

and so the us congress after several months of debates , decided to launch a federal agency to conduct all non-millitary activity in space , and as a result The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A) was created, which soon became what we know as NASA

The Apollo program

the apollo program , was really innovator, because it had as a goal to land humans on the moon and bring them safe back home ,however this wasn’t easy at all, the apollo 1 ended tragically when during an experimental simulation , the astraunauts died due to fire in the command module. this terrible accident,the nasa was obliged to stop the program and do other tests !!

the deliverance came on july 20 , 1969 when apollo 11 when neil armstrong and buzz aldrin landed were the first men to land on the moon !!

the appollo program helped also by bringing to earth a wealth of scientific data and almost 400 kilograms of lunar sample includind meteoroids, soil mechanics , and even solar winds experiments

Skylab

slylab was the second big project of the nasa, slylab is a 75 tonne space station that was in orbit around earth from 1973 to 1979 , it included also a laboratory for studying the effects of microgravity, and a solar observatory, the skylab was intended to study gravitational anomalies in solar systems, but the program was stoped due to lack of funding and interest.

Shuttle era

maybe the main program that nasa focused on since late 1970

the space shuttle was planned to be frequently launchable and reusable , by 1985 four space shuttles were built , and the first to be launched was columbia on april 12 ,1981 .

this mission faced problems also , mainly due to the fact that the flights were much more costing than what was initially considered , and also in 1986 with the the challenger disaster that pushed the nasa to provide more efforts to face the risks o space flight .

this program also helped to create a great collaboration between space agencies from all around the world , the hubble space telescope is an example of this strong collaboration
